According to EPA Safe Drinking Water Information System (SDWIS), MUSTANG WATER AUTHORITY (PWSID CO0143525) in Nucla, CO is listed as a CWS water system covering about 0 people. The same extract lists 15 health-based violation records spanning 2019-2023. Those 15 health-based rows for MUSTANG WATER AUTHORITY cover contaminants such as Interim Enhanced Surface Water Treatment Rule, Surface Water Treatment Rule, Stage 1 Disinfectants and Disinfection Byproducts Rule; they remain historical EPA registry entries, not a current compliance or drinkability score.

PlainEnviro's health-based SDWIS extract covers monitoring and reporting violations only -- it does not include unresolved enforcement actions in progress or corrective steps a utility has taken since the extract date. 3 distinct EPA contaminant codes appear in this system's record, including Interim Enhanced Surface Water Treatment Rule, Surface Water Treatment Rule, Stage 1 Disinfectants and Disinfection Byproducts Rule. Recorded violations span 2019–2023. Day-to-day primacy enforcement for this system runs through the Colorado drinking-water program, not EPA directly.

A historical health-based record does not necessarily describe current water quality or compliance. The most authoritative current source is the utility's annual Consumer Confidence Report. For enforcement history and corrective-action orders, consult EPA ECHO and the Colorado state drinking-water program's public portal.
